pub struct PluginRunData {
pub package: Option<String>,
pub version: Option<String>,
pub state: Option<String>,
pub reporting_event: Option<String>,
pub title: Option<String>,
pub summary: Option<String>,
pub text: Option<String>,
}
Fields§
§package: Option<String>
§version: Option<String>
§state: Option<String>
§reporting_event: Option<String>
§title: Option<String>
§summary: Option<String>
§text: Option<String>
Implementations§
Source§impl PluginRunData
impl PluginRunData
pub fn new() -> PluginRunData
Trait Implementations§
Source§impl Clone for PluginRunData
impl Clone for PluginRunData
Source§fn clone(&self) -> PluginRunData
fn clone(&self) -> PluginRunData
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for PluginRunData
impl Debug for PluginRunData
Source§impl<'de> Deserialize<'de> for PluginRunData
impl<'de> Deserialize<'de> for PluginRunData
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for PluginRunData
impl PartialEq for PluginRunData
Source§impl Serialize for PluginRunData
impl Serialize for PluginRunData
impl StructuralPartialEq for PluginRunData
Auto Trait Implementations§
impl Freeze for PluginRunData
impl RefUnwindSafe for PluginRunData
impl Send for PluginRunData
impl Sync for PluginRunData
impl Unpin for PluginRunData
impl UnwindSafe for PluginRunData
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more